While mixing folk music and electronics has become one of the musical trends of the 21st Century, Beth Orton has been exploring this arena since the mid-1990s.
She was first heard as a languid vocalist on tracks by dance producer William Orbit before her Mercury Prize-nominated debut album, Trailer Park, and 1999's Central Reservation explored the nexus between city rhythms and rural tones.
As the new genre of folktronica emerged in her wake, Orton left the electronics to delve deeper into the English folk music she had always loved, finding a bridge between Sandy Denny, Carole King and the bruising honesty of modern songwriters.
After a five-year absence from Australia, and in anticipation of her soon-to-be released album on Anti- Records, Orton plays in the intimate space of City Recital Hall.
